
Shredded Chicken Quesadilla

Cuisine: Mexican
Difficulty: EASY
Prep.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 40 minutes
Servings: 6 Servings
Calories: 606 kcal per serving
Ingredients
- 2 - Chicken breasts
- 15 ounces - Black beans
- ½ - Purple onion
- ½ - Bell pepper
- 2 cups - cheese
- ⅓ cup - Fresh salsa
- 2 tablespoons - Oil
- 2 tablespoons - Garlic
- ½ tsp - Chili powder
- 1 tsp - Cumin
- 1 tsp - Paprika
- 8 - Burrito sized tortillas
- 2 stalk - Green onion
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 425℉.
- In a large skillet, sauté the diced onion and bell pepper with 1 tablespoon of oil.
- Add garlic, chicken, beans, spices, oil and salsa. Stir and cook for 1 minute.
- Spray sheet pan with oil and place tortillas half-on half-off of the pan.
- Fill the middle of tortillas with chicken mixture. Add cheese and green onions. Place remaining tortillas in center to cover the middle area. Fold over the outside tortillas and place another sprayed sheet pan on top to keep tortillas closed.
- Bake in preheated oven for 20 minutes.
- Remove from oven and cut into 6 pieces.
